**Checklist item 7 — Thumbnail generation queue (Pellview release)**

Before sign-off at the weekly eng sync, confirm the Snapwright thumbnail queue drains to zero under the new worker pool sizing. Verify that oversized source images route to the fallback resizer instead of blocking the queue head, and that retry counts stay below three per job across a full staging replay. Capture the queue-depth graph for the sync deck. The staging replay ran against the following build.

build token for kagaf-hahof: htk14_9d3d4d26d7d8de

### Changelog — Scanlark barcode integration

Defaults changed this sprint: the decoder now retries twice on partial reads, and unknown symbologies are logged rather than rejected. Handheld units pick this up on next sync; fixed stations need a restart. No action required unless you've overridden the decode path. New default configuration shipping with this release:

deployment values, fahap-hahaf:
[casdor]
port = 9200
region = south-2
host = casdor.qirvanworks.corp
timeout_ms = 3000
retries = 4

## Authentication

Tracelight propagates request IDs across all Harbrook microservices. Support queries against the trace store require auth. No anonymous reads. Tokens are service-scoped; the support tier gets read-only access to spans, logs, and dependency maps. Do not reuse tokens across environments — staging and prod stores are separate. Tokens rotate monthly; expired tokens return 401 with a `trace-auth-expired` header. If a customer ticket needs trace lookup, use the shared support credential. The current read-only key follows.

gateway credential: kto23_LX9A4ys6i4nzHtpOLNLodKK

### Runbook: BounceBroom — Account Recovery

If the BounceBroom email bounce processor loses access to its service account, do not create a new one. First, pause the intake queue so bounces buffer safely. Then open the recovery console and select the BounceBroom principal. Verification requires approval from the on-call lead. Once approved, the console prompts for the stored recovery credentials; enter the passphrase that appears directly below this paragraph.

recovery phrase for fahof-kahap: holion-gormir-jorix-istix-briwyn-sorael